Holistic altcoin trend analysis methodology for market forecasting

When it comes to understanding altcoins, it helps to mix technical, fundamental, and emotion-based cues together. Altcoins like Ethereum, Ripple, and Litecoin each have their own perks, think faster transactions or a focus on privacy. In a market that can shift quickly and behave in complicated ways, blending these different factors is key. By looking at core data like price charts, trading volume, liquidity, and market capitalization alongside hints from Bitcoin patterns (for example, a Golden Cross, which can signal a rise, or a Death Cross, which might warn of a drop), investors get a clearer picture of what’s happening.

We break down this process into five simple steps:

  1. Data Collection: Start by gathering both current and past market data. Keep an eye on price trends and sudden spikes in volume.
  2. Indicator Configuration: Set up tools like moving averages and oscillators. These help catch shifts in trends as they form.
  3. On-chain Metric Review: Look into blockchain details such as the number of transactions and active addresses. This shows how lively and active a coin is.
  4. Sentiment Assessment: Check social and news media to see how investors feel. It’s important to filter out noise from hype or unusual drops in liquidity.
  5. Risk Controls: Finally, use tools like stop-loss orders and adjust your position sizes according to market swings to help protect your investment.

Each of these steps builds on the last. You start with a solid base of data, then use technical tools to interpret it. Reviewing on-chain metrics adds another layer of insight, while sentiment checks reveal real-time moods in the market. And by putting risk controls in place, you’re better prepared for sudden moves. Together, this framework makes it easier to understand fast-changing market conditions and make smarter investment decisions when it comes to digital assets.

Momentum indicators act like a quick guide when altcoin markets get bumpy. They help traders instantly see whether a trend is strong enough or if it might fade soon. In choppy times, these tools cut through the chatter to show clear shifts in market mood and price movement, letting you know if an altcoin is about to surge or dip so you can adjust your plan right away.

Simple Moving Averages (SMA) and Exponential Moving Averages (EMA) are basic tools that show the overall direction of the market. When these averages cross one another, it often hints that the trend is about to change. Then there’s the MACD, or Moving Average Convergence Divergence, which compares these averages to confirm if the market is on an upswing (bullish) or a downswing (bearish). If you want to dive a bit deeper, check out this crypto technical analysis guide. Their clear visual cues make it easier to figure out the right times to jump in or step back out of the market.

Other tools, like the Relative Strength Index (RSI) and the Stochastic Oscillator, are really handy for spotting when a coin might be too expensive or too cheap. They measure how quickly prices are moving, which can warn you early about possible reversals. Meanwhile, Bollinger Bands help you understand market volatility by showing when prices are tightening or expanding, adding extra context to those momentum signals.

Support and resistance levels outline zones where prices might stall or reverse direction. Often, these areas are backed up by Fibonacci retracements, which nail down potential turning points. Recognizing chart patterns, think Head & Shoulders, Double Tops/Bottoms, triangles, and flags, adds another layer of insight. When these patterns come along with high trading volume, they confirm that a breakout or breakdown is likely, helping you choose the perfect moments to enter or exit your trades.

On-chain metrics and fundamental insights in altcoin trend analysis methodology

Network indicators form the backbone of altcoin analysis. They include simple counts like the number of transactions, active addresses (which show how many users are engaging), and the network hash rate (a measure of the computing power securing the network). For instance, if active addresses suddenly rise, it’s much like seeing more shoppers outside a favorite store, hinting at growing interest.

Tokenomics adds an extra layer of understanding. It examines factors like the circulating supply and overall market value of a coin, both of which can shape how its price moves, sometimes leading to more volatility (price changes). Also, taking the time to review the credentials of the development team, their partnerships, and upcoming upgrades can tell you a lot about the coin’s real potential, kind of like checking under the hood before a long drive.

Another key insight comes from watching how altcoins react to Bitcoin. Research shows that Bitcoin’s market swings can often guide altcoin trends, creating a kind of ripple effect. When you add in liquidity details (which indicate how easy it is to buy or sell the coin), you get a fuller, more rounded view of what might lie ahead.

All in all, by mixing on-chain data with basic financial indicators, investors can build a smarter, more complete picture of digital assets.

Sentiment & volume surge confirmation in altcoin trend analysis methodology

img-2.jpg

Market sentiment data picks up real-time hints from sites like Twitter, Reddit, and news sites, giving us a quick snapshot of how investors are feeling. It shows whether people are feeling hopeful or cautious about the market. But sometimes, these feelings can be warped by short-term excitement or coordinated schemes that push prices up and then down suddenly. Traders need to double-check these signals against steadier data so they can filter out any noise before making a move.

Volume surges are another helpful clue. When you see a sudden jump in trading volume, it often means actual buyers and sellers are stepping in, not just fake moves. Advanced tools that spot odd trading patterns can weed out false signals, especially during times when trading isn’t very smooth. By confirming that a volume spike really means new investor interest, these approaches add a layer of clarity when you’re watching for quick breakouts or potential reversals. Mixing in volume data with other technical hints makes it easier to decide when to enter or exit a trade, strengthening your overall strategy.

Risk management & forecasting integration in altcoin trend analysis methodology

img-3.jpg

When trading digital currencies that can swing wildly, using stop-loss orders and careful position sizing is key. Stop-loss orders help you cut losses if the market takes an unexpected dive, while position sizing means you only risk an amount you're comfy with. Think of it like dipping your toe in the water with a small portion of your portfolio, instead of jumping in headfirst.

Tools like ATR and historical volatility can guide you through the market. These tools, by measuring market jitters, help you decide the best times to buy or sell. Imagine checking the weather: if a storm is coming, you might wait it out and only act when things calm down. That kind of foresight lets you adjust your trade sizes and timing, making each move more deliberate.

Finally, keeping your risk management and forecasting methods up-to-date is crucial. Regularly checking your risk-reward ratios and tracking losses helps you fine-tune your strategy based on real market behavior. By constantly tweaking your parameters, you ensure that your method stays on point even when the market shifts unexpectedly.

F1 2026: Key Meetings on Engine Rules and Race Start Safety Could Impact Season Before Australia GP

Two critical meetings scheduled for Wednesday during Formula 1's final 2026 pre-season test in Bahrain could prove more influential than the on-track action taking place at the circuit. With the Australian season opener less than three weeks away, these gatherings will address controversial issues that have dominated pre-season conversations and threaten to reshape competitive balance before the campaign begins. The Power Unit Advisory Committee, featuring all five engine manufacturers alongside the FIA and Formula One Management, will meet to resolve the season's most contentious technical dispute regarding compression ratio limits on the sport's new power units. A second meeting will also take place to address additional matters affecting the grid as teams prepare for their final test session before heading to Melbourne.

Barcelona F1 Grand Prix Extended Until 2032 in Rotation Deal With Belgian GP at Spa

The Circuit de Barcelona-Catalunya has secured its place in Formula 1 through 2032, following confirmation of a new agreement that will see the venue alternate annually with Belgium's iconic Spa-Francorchamps circuit. Under the newly announced arrangement, Barcelona will host races in 2028, 2030, and 2032, running alongside the Madrid event, which has secured a permanent spot on the calendar through 2035. The Catalan venue was facing an uncertain future as its previous contract was set to expire, with the introduction of a Madrid street circuit in 2026 casting doubt over Barcelona's continued participation in the championship.
